Lovable
🌎 lovable.devLovable is a software development company that specializes in building AI-powered applications through a chat interface. The company focuses on rapid experimentation and aims to simplify the software development process, allowing users to create fully functional web applications quickly and efficiently. With a team of experienced founders and engineers, Lovable has developed a product that leverages open-source code generation and large language models to empower both developers and non-developers in app creation.
Lovable - Latest News and Updates
- Lovable, a Swedish AI agent startup, recently raised $15 million in a pre-Series A round.
- Lovable has implemented the Sonnet 3.7 AI model to enhance coding and design capabilities, resulting in improved performance.
- Creandum is leading Lovable's pre-series A round to accelerate its growth as a potential European AI leader.
- Lovable, along with Replit Agent and Bolt.new, enhances prototyping speed for PMs and designers by integrating LLM capabilities into Figma.
- Lovable developed an end-to-end app using Grok API for creating AI chatbots.
- Lovable is developing AI-powered visual web development tools with features like automatic responsive layouts and semantic code generation.
- Lovable is projected to reach $100 million in revenue before the end of the year, attracting attention from Stripe.
- Lovable has adopted Sonnet 3.7 for its main workflow due to its impressive coding and design capabilities.
- Lovable conducted an A/B test showing improved performance on their platform.
